“Which brand Should I…” – You might have experience asking this question to yourself while shopping online or at Walmart for natural puppy food. You should understand that not all manufactured dog food contains the right amounts of protein, antioxidants and nutrients to sustain your puppies needs. To add, some brands contain wheat and corn gluten that are mainly fillers that make your pet feel full, but does not contain enough nutrients. Lastly, some dog food brands contain ingredients that can trigger dog food allergies. This is the reason why you should choose natural food for your puppy instead of regular ones.

So, which all natural puppy food brand should YOU buy?

Natural Balance Puppy Food
Your puppies can begin on nibbling moist Natural Balance before they are weaned; feed three times a day, from six weeks up to the sixth months. After that, you can start feeding Natural Balance Dry Dog Food. Start with the recommended amounts and you may also add small amounts of Natural Balance Canned Dog Food for ease of feeding.

Natural Choice Puppy Food
Natural Choice is from the Nutro Company. Feeding your pup with Natural Choice will result in smaller, more compact stools because the food is easily digestible and are less likely to be expelled as waste. Natural Choice dog food are also fortified with linoleic acid. Linoleic fatty acid helps promote healthy skin and a sleek coat.

Natural Life Puppy Food
Natural Life offers a very straightforward, unadulterated and naturally nutritious puppy food. Natural Life puppy food does not contain artificial preservatives, colors or flavors that can promote cancer or other serious illnesses that your dog may acquire by eating the wrong food. Their formula includes wholesome meats like chicken, lamb and venison without the by-products and they incorporate whole grains to the meal for added energy.
